The word 'should' is not very useful. It creates a feeling that there is 'one way' to do something that you must adhere to. Or that you are failing because you're not in line with some image of where you 'should' be. All this does nothing but create pressure and anxiety within us. We start to punish ourselves for not adhering to all these 'shoulds' and it just all creates a shitty, unproductive feeling. And that's what I talk about in the podcast this week. I talk about...
